It was reported by 'Weekly Bunshun' that Wakai Koto of Mrs. GREEN APPLE and Nina of NiziU are in a close relationship. According to the report, the two have deepened their relationship since last year and have developed into a relationship where they visit each other's homes and stay overnight. Regarding Wakai Koto, in March of this year, 'FRIDAY' reported on an overnight date with gravure idol Ichika Minori, and this report has raised suspicions that he may have been in a romantic relationship with two women simultaneously. The management of NiziU, 'Sony Music Labels,' commented on the relationship with Wakai, stating, 'It is true that they became close recently due to guitar. It is merely a relationship of mutual respect between seniors and juniors.' Mrs. GREEN APPLE's agency, 'Project-MGA,' revealed, 'There were items that differed from the facts, but basically, we leave the private matters to the individual. We will continue to communicate closely with them.' NiziU performed at the music festival 'The Performance' celebrating TV Asahi's 65th anniversary last April, where they had their first joint live performance with Mrs. GREEN APPLE. Furthermore, in January of this year, they collaborated with Mrs. GREEN APPLE's vocalist Motoki Omori on the YouTube channel 'THE FIRST TAKE,' where Omori provided the ballad 'AlwayS,' which he wrote, composed, and produced, garnering attention. Given that there has been interaction between the groups for some time, many fans were shocked by this report. Additionally, since their debut, NiziU has been active in Korea, and Mrs. GREEN APPLE successfully held their first solo concert in Seoul in February this year, both being known as popular artists in Korea. Fans are concerned that future reports may impact their activities in Korea, and attention is focused on further developments.
